Everything needed to make this side dish should be readily available at your local supermarket. The one thing you may have to ask after is the rapini. Thankfully, it’s now standard fare for most of the year so if you don’t see it, ask your grocer.

Fresh rapini

RAPINI

Rapini or broccoli rabe is a powerhouse of vitamins and minerals. Experts tell us it can help boost energy, build collagen, reduce the risk of stroke and cancer, plus help reach your daily dose of both vitamins C and K! Geez, talk about a healthy green, rapini sounds perfect.

The rapini blanched fr a few moments in boiling water

Although some claim rapini can taste a bit bitter, the use of lemon in this recipe counters it. Say goodbye to bitter and hello to delicious!

Rapini with Garlic and Parmesan

Ingredients

  • 1 bunch rapini, ends trimmed
  • 1 tablespoon extra virgin olive oil
  • 1 tablespoon butter
  • 3 garlic cloves, finely diced
  • 1 teaspoon chili flakes
  • sprinkle of kosher salt
  • juice from half a lemon
  • ¼ cup of shaved Parmesan cheese

Directions

  1. Cook rapini in a pot of boiling water for 2 minutes. Strain and immediately transfer to an ice bath to cool. Lay cooked rapini onto a clean dish towel to dry.
  2. Heat oil and melt butter in a large skillet set to medium-high heat. Add garlic and chili flakes and cook until fragrant. Add rapini, salt and lemon juice. Toss the rapini in the pan to heat.
  3. Transfer to service platter, garnish with Parmesan and serve.
